DRV8843 Sleep line question

Other Parts Discussed in Thread: DRV8843

I have a customer that is using the DRV8843 in a stepper motor drive applicaiton.  They have noticed a strange phenomenon and would like to understand if they are doing something wrong.  I will try to describe the steps to recreate the issue:

Their MCU controls the sleep line in the application (not enable).The MCU moves sleep to high rotates the stepper motor and then moves sleep to low.  All is working as expected.  Now the customer wants to keep power on the stepper motor at all times, so they simply cut the trace on the sleep line and tie it to 5V (VM).  Now only half of the DRV8843 is active.  The other half does not even try to fire.

  • Hi Jarrett,

    Some follow up questions...

    1. Can you provide a schematic of the circuit and where precisely the line was cut and tied to? I am confused when you say tied to 5V (VM). VM for this device can only go down to 8.2V.

    2. Can you clarrify on what you mean by half does not work? One of the h-bridges? Which h-bridge? Any other functions?

    3. Can they try this mod on a different PCB? Is it possibly they damaged some of the other traces when they made the mod. It would be good to verify the connections of all the DRV inputs.
